Reimagining the Classic: A Lighter Approach

Traditional Alfredo sauce relies heavily on heavy cream, resulting in a rich, decadent sauce that can sometimes be overpowering. In this recipe, we’re taking a different approach, using a combination of milk, Parmesan cheese, and a touch of butter to create a luscious, creamy sauce that’s both flavorful and guilt-free.

Ingredients: Simplicity at Its Finest

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, sliced into strips
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ups milk
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up grated Romano cheese
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/8 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
  • 1 pound fettuccine noodles, cooked according to package instructions

Step-by-Step Guide: From Prep to Plate

1. Prepare the Chicken: Season the chicken strips with salt and pepper.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the chicken and cook until golden brown and cooked through. Remove from the skillet and set aside.

2. Sauté the Aromatics: In the same skillet, add the onion and garlic. Cook until the onion is translucent and the garlic is fragrant, about 2 minutes.

3. Create the Roux: Stir in the flour and cook for 1 minute, or until the mixture turns golden brown. This roux will serve as the base for our creamy sauce.

4. Incorporate the Milk: Gradually whisk in the milk, stirring constantly to avoid lumps. Bring the mixture to a simmer and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until the sauce has thickened.

5. Add the Cheeses: Stir in the Parmesan and Romano cheeses, allowing them to melt and blend into the sauce.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

6. Combine the Chicken and Sauce: Return the cooked chicken to the skillet with the sauce. Stir to coat the chicken evenly.

7. Serve Over Pasta: Place the cooked fettuccine noodles on a serving platter. Top with the chicken Alfredo sauce and sprinkle with fresh parsley.

Tips for a Perfect Chicken Alfredo

  • Choosing the Right Pasta: Fettuccine is the traditional pasta for Alfredo sauce, but you can use any long pasta of your choice, such as spaghetti, linguine, or tagliatelle.
  • Cooking the Chicken: You can grill, pan-fry, or bake the chicken breasts. Just make sure they are cooked through before adding them to the sauce.
  • Adjusting the Sauce Consistency: If you prefer a thicker sauce, add more cheese or simmer it for a few minutes longer. For a thinner sauce, add more milk or broth.

Variations: Adding Your Own Twist

  • Vegetables Galore: Add your favorite vegetables to the sauce, such as broccoli, zucchini, mushrooms, or spinach.
  • Herbs and Spices: Enhance the flavor of the sauce with a sprinkle of dried or fresh herbs, such as basil, oregano, thyme, or rosemary. You can also add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a hint of spice.
  • Protein Alternatives: Feel free to substitute the chicken with shrimp, tofu, or vegetables for a vegetarian version.

FAQs: Addressing Your Burning Questions

Q: Can I use skim milk instead of whole milk?

A: Yes, you can use skim milk or 2% milk for a lighter sauce. However, whole milk will yield a richer, creamier texture.

Q: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

A: Yes, you can prepare the sauce and cook the chicken in advance. Store them separ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. When ready to serve, reheat the sauce and chicken gently and toss with the cooked pasta.

Q: What are some side dishes that pair well with chicken Alfredo?

A: Roasted vegetables, such as broccoli, zucchini, or asparagus, are excellent accompaniments to chicken Alfredo. You can also serve it with a side salad or garlic bread for a complete meal.
